Output e0c1386ec3cdd713b8d65aa945f7571a4259f3623ba2e7c8f2ef1f330d6c9fef:1

value
677141268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f03de20758c464c01d5ce5eda77187761d7e8de OP_EQUAL
address
MGZZ4PJhhmHSQK31jo5FjswdZYbReHv4ux
transaction
e0c1386ec3cdd713b8d65aa945f7571a4259f3623ba2e7c8f2ef1f330d6c9fef
spent
true